We judge ourselves on our ability to help clients anticipate and respond to changing market conditions and to create opportunities that merit the trust they place in us.BUSINESS UNIT OVERVIEWThis role is part of the Listed Derivatives Operations team based in Bengaluru which is part of the broader Securities Division. We are present globally across the major GS offices, i.e. Tokyo, Singapore, Bangalore, London, Warsaw, New York and Salt Lake City. We have a global remit and provide support to various Futures exchanges globally. Working closely with multiple internal and external clients and counter parties by validating, allocating and resolving queries associated with futures and listed options trades. The team is also responsible for proactively identifying ways to improve processes to achieve overall efficiency and effectiveness. The candidate must be flexible with work-hours.RESPONSIBILITIES AND QUALIFICATIONSJOB SUMMARY & RESPONSIBILIIESThe team is responsible for clearing; matching, reconciling and margining the futures and options trades across various futures exchanges. The candidate will be responsible to ensure functions are performed accurately in a timely manner. Key functions of Listed Derivatives Operations in Bangalore are as follows:

Allocation and booking of client trades in GS systems.

Reconciliation of GS books and records to the exchanges.

Exchange and Intercompany margining.

Reconciliation of consistency across GS entities and among various ledgers.

Client and sales support for Listed Derivatives statement delivery.

Monitor and follow up with counterparty brokers on trade and brokerage related queries.

Generating various reports for regulators and internal clients.

Testing new systems and architectures.
